  3. Happy National IPA Day

    With so many beer holidays on the calendar, it’s difficult to keep track of them all. One beer holiday I always anticipate is National IPA Day. This holiday was established in 2011 by Ashley Rousten, a beer enthusiast and author of the book, "The Beer Wench's Guide to Beer: An Unpretentious Guide to Craft Beer."   4. Great American Beer Festival goes virtual in 2020

    2020 has been quite a year, so why not treat yourself to some great American beer this October? The 38th annual Great American Beer Festival (GABF), the premier U.S. beer festival and competition, will look a little different this year as it moves online.   5. Beer-to-go during the pandemic

    In mid-March, growing concern over the COVID-19 pandemic forced breweries into a difficult corner, as states issued orders closing taprooms across the country. Then, almost as quickly as some states started to reopen, a growing number of states began pausing plans to reopen or re-imposing restrictions previously lifted, amid rising positive coronavirus cases.   7. Celebrating American Craft Beer Week

    American Craft Beer Week® is the national celebration of small and independent craft brewers and the American beer culture. Held annually, this year’s American Craft Beer Week will be celebrated May 13-19, 2019.
